Semantic Drift

When words stop meaning what they used to. Over time, phrases get watered down, co-opted, or twisted until they lose their original punch. Think “literally,” “authentic,” or “disruption.”
Startup bros calling every idea ‘disruptive’ is just semantic drift in action.

AI drift

The gradual loss of context in long AI conversations. The model slowly forgets earlier details, starts making stuff up, or goes completely off-topic because it has no real understanding and refuses to ask for clarification. Forces you to abandon the session and start over.

Coined November 10 2025 by developer Joshua Girod after building AI Driftmaster – an open-source tool that saves full uncompacted chat history in a database so you can reload context anytime.

Opposite of human conversation – we say "wait, what were we talking about?" AI just hallucinates forward.
